Allow Your Eyes to Adjust
It’s time for lights out! For a full thirty minutes, allow your eyes to get used to the complete darkness. Turn off all screens and white lights. If you need light, try a red light! It’s easier on your eyes, and shouldn’t disrupt them much as they adjust. Eventually, you’ll start to notice more depth as you peer at the sky. The stars will just seem to continuously appear deeper and deeper in the sky right before your own eyes! This is also a great excuse to get everyone off their screens before bed. Flashlight Tag
This is a super fun, classic variation of tag. And it’s easy to do since everyone has a flashlight or headlamp in their tent accessories! Players will scatter across the campsite. Whoever is “it” has the flashlight and must shine the beam on a player to tag them. There are lots of ways to customize the game and change the rules to your liking. No matter how you play, this is a fan favorite and an easy way to expel some energy before bed.
Glowstick Art
Glow sticks hardly take up any space, so they’re easy to pack! Bring a bunch for everyone to enjoy after dark. Either spend time making jewelry to wear or pretend they’re magic wands. Use glow sticks to draw light pictures in the air. Turn it into a guessing game, too, where all the campers write down a word or action and put it in a hat or bowl. Then, a player draws a word and must try to draw that item in the air with the glowstick. Everyone else has to guess what it is!
Campfire Charades
On a similar note, nighttime charades are super fun! Split into two even teams. Everyone contributes a noun or action to a bowl, and players draw. By the light of the fire, players then have one minute to act out– without making any sounds– the item they drew. The first team to guess correctly gets a point!

Rounds of Mafia
This mystery-type game is perfect in the dark. Campers will gather around the fire for this one. All you need is a deck of cards and some creativity. A selected narrator will facilitate the game. They’ll hand out cards to each player, face-down. These cards assign roles to certain individuals: the Mafia, Doctor, Detective, and Townspeople. The game evolves into a murder mystery that every camper gets involved in. Get creative! Some people really enjoy elaborate storytelling, so the game can extend quite a bit.

Outdoor Movie Night
This one is a super fun and creative way to unwind and feel extra cozy. Project a movie onto the side of a camping tent, or onto a tarp. With a pre-downloaded movie and a portable projector, this is easy to pull off. Kids, especially, will love the outdoor sleepover vibes! Don’t forget all the snacks. Popcorn and s’mores are a must. On a cold night, a cup of hot chocolate or coffee is the perfect movie snack. Everyone should have headphones, to ensure they abide by quiet hours at the campground.
